Reporting to Department Administrator, the Executive Assistant supports the Department Chair of Microbiology and Immunology and provides professional‑level administrative and operational support, including: calendaring, departmental correspondence, travel, special event planning, faculty recruitment visits, tenure and promotion activities, and general support to the department’s faculty and staff as needed. This role will serve as a primary point of contact for day‑to‑day administrative needs of the Chair, Administrator, and all assigned department activities.

Duties & Responsibilities

Interacting face‑to‑face with the Chair for daily administrative needs. Greet visitors and ensure Chair remains on schedule.

Anticipate the needs of the Department’s senior leadership including scheduling meetings and coordinating accurate, timely communication.

Coordinate and prepare all aspects of meeting arrangements to include invitations; location and set‑up, equipment needed; meeting documentation (agenda, presentations, and handouts); and meeting arrangements (catering, parking, travel arrangements, etc.).

Attend meetings to take notes and record meeting minutes as requested.

Faculty recruitment – coordinates faculty recruitment visits to include scheduling, itinerary creation, and escorting faculty candidates to and from appointments while on campus.

Assist Chair with the Promotion and Tenure (PNT) process to include navigating the PNT system, meeting with Committee Chairs to review the PNT process, updating the PNT system with documents from each review committee, including final voting pages and letters of support from the Committee Chair and Department Chair ensuring all school deadlines are met and PNT files are in compliance with School guidelines.

Fiscal Support

Manages travel, including creating pre‑approval requests for Chair‑invited guests and faculty recruits in ChromeRiver, paying registration fees (where applicable) and processing reimbursements within established guidelines. This includes offering travel training to new travelers.

Maintains a departmental Procurement Card (P‑Card) for supplies, registration fees, guest lunches, and other incidentals as requested. Is available on site to receive and distribute P‑card orders. Maintains documentation and reconciles purchases by posted deadlines.

Timekeeper

Ensures required information is submitted by employees and approved by supervisors by HR’s deadline each pay period.

Carefully calculate, report, reconcile and monitor leave balances.

Answer all employee and supervisor queries regarding use of and correction or approval of entries into RealTime timekeeping system.

Work with the payroll office to correct errors, report system problems, etc.
